| Harrods Group Sees Profits Plummet |

Pre-tax profits for Harrods Limited, the group that owns the London department store as well as concessions at London airports, saw a dramatic 68 per cent fall in pre-tax profits to GBP7 million in the 52 weeks to February 1 2003. Sales rose slightly from GBP458 to GBP461m. Harrods attributed the fall in profits to a world downturn affecting tourism and travel. |
